The Pittsboro Farmers Market is open year-round and features select items from within a 50-mile radius. They are open every Thursday, 3pm-6pm, under the solar panels at The Plant. The product-only market features baked goods, eggs, flowers, honey, jams/jellies, soaps, plants, poultry, and other meats. Vendors include Celebrity Dairy, In Good Heart Farm, and Vortex... |

The Plant presents the 18th Annual PepperFest on Sun, Sep 14, 12pm-6pm. PepperFest is a celebration of sustainable agriculture, local farmers, and the creativity of the Piedmont’s top chefs, brewers, and artisans. The event features peppers grown on-site in the Pepper Patch, a hot sauce contest, a variety of Pepper-Themed food and drinks from The...
